Preparing for the Tu Bishvat Seder at home: To aid your participation in the seder, you will need to have both white and red wine or juice and some of the following foods on hand. You are also welcomed to have your own meal to insert when we get to the “Festive Meal” in the Haggadah.
For the first symbolic and spiritual level (Assiyah, “doing”), you may choose from: Only need (at least) one fruit or nut for each level. Walnuts, Almonds, Peanuts, Hazelnuts, Pistachios, Pomegranate, Grapefruit, Pineapple, Coconut, Banana, Kiwi, Orange, Tangerine
For the second level (Yetzirah, “formation”), you may choose from: Olives, Dates, Peaches, Plums, Apricots, Cherries
For the third level (Briyah, “creation”), you may choose from: Fig, Raisins, Apples, Seedless Grapes, Raspberries, Pears, Blueberries, Strawberries, Carobs, Cranberries
